Methodology: How We Ranked the Best Solar Companies in Edgmont
EcoWatch's solar experts analyzed each solar company in Edgmont based on criteria such as its reputation in the industry, customer reviews, services, warranty coverage and financing. Using this solar methodology, we used the data we collected to rate and rank each company and narrow down our picks for the best solar companies in Edgmont
Below are some the criteria we examined specifically for Pennsylvania solar companies
- Brand reputation and certifications (20%): We take each company's Better Business Bureau (BBB) score into consideration, as well as how long the installer has been in business (at least 5 years is required, 10 preferred) and what type of solar certifications it holds.
- Customer reviews (20%): Trust is a top priority at EcoWatch, so we take customer experience under close consideration. We scour different review sites and customer testimonials when ranking our top solar companies, checking sites such as Trustpilot and Google Reviews. We also consider any potential complaints or lawsuits filed against these companies and award or remove points accordingly.
- Warranty (20%): A company earns a perfect score in this category if it offers 25-year warranties that cover performance, product and workmanship. The industry standard that we measure companies against is 25-year product and performance warranties, along with a 10-year workmanship warranty. We also look closely into the track record of the post-installation support each company provides in terms of honoring its contracts
- Solar services (10%): All of the companies we review install solar panels, but we award companies higher points if they offer additional services for customers, like battery installation, energy-efficiency audits, and EV chargers.
- Pricing and financing (10%): It's hard to get exact quotes for solar projects, but we use marketplace research to determine how each company prices its equipment and installation services. Additionally, companies that offer more help for panel financing — like in-house loans, leases, or PPAs — score higher than those that don't.
- Availability (10%): The bigger the service area, the higher the company will score.
- Transparency and accessibility (5%): Solar installers that offer free consultations and easy contact methods score higher in this category.
- Environmental, social and corporate governance factors (5%): A company earns a perfect score in this category if it offers public data disclosure, addresses end-of-life (EOL) products or processes, and demonstrates a commitment to uplifting the communities that it serves.
The Cost and Benefits of Solar in Edgmont
We know that for many homeowners, the decision to invest in solar rests on installation costs.The cost and possible savings vary depending on some important factors such as:
- The amount of sunlight your roof gets: If your rooftop doesn’t get a lot of direct sunlight, your solar system won’t be able to generate as much energy, which will leave you with lower savings on energy bills than someone with a roof that gets lots of sunlight.
- System size and type: Some models are more expensive than others, so the one you get can raise or lower your initial investment. Plus, the more solar panels you need to get, the more it'll cost.
- Your energy consumption: If your household regularly uses a lot of energy, you'll see more savings from installing solar panels.

Is it worth installing solar panels on my home?
Solar panels can be a good investment for a majority of homeowners, but truthfully, they might not be worth it for everyone. If your home doesn't get a lot of direct sunlight or your power bills are already reasonably low, solar panels might not be for you.
What is the best kind of solar panel?
The different types of solar panels are monocrystalline, polycrystalline and thin-film. Monocrystalline panels are more efficient but also more expensive. Polycrystalline panels cost less but also less efficient than monocrystalline. Thin-film solar panels are flexible, so they can be used where the other kinds can’t, like on curved surfaces or cars, but they are also less efficient. The best one for you depends on your budget, roof layout and how much efficiency you're looking for.
